The Navy IPO is responsible for managing and implementing International Security Assistance programs, Cooperative Development programs, and Technology Security policy. Security Cooperation (SC) is a critical aspect of protecting US interests and is an overriding goal of our organization. Navy IPO was established in 1989 to support the goals and objectives of friends and allies to build and maintain their defenses against common adversaries. Today, Navy IPO's mission is to build, strengthen and maintain maritime partnerships while advancing interoperability with out network of nations that encompass the joint services, industry and international partners. Navy IPO's SC programs continue to provide our maritime partners with access to US defense industry partners and the means to obtain military defense articles, services, logistics support, and training.
